Output 21e58623a9bfad8c1a7a603252e758a33e5fcee63b146ee7ae279d10e93e8247:1

value
25344846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0612681e165a7ecff81741a1ac7373def4d5dc2e OP_EQUALVERIFY OP_CHECKSIG
address
1Z7759hZCmWgJoLbqFVmgtqjtsf9LcfEY
transaction
21e58623a9bfad8c1a7a603252e758a33e5fcee63b146ee7ae279d10e93e8247
confirmations
412322
spent
true